Brown-Driver-Briggs /Thayer Dictionary - רַע
רַע
H7451
Transliteration: raʻ
Pronunciation: rah
Definition: adversity
Original: רעה רע Transliteration: ra‛ râ‛âh Phonetic: rah
BDB Definition:
- bad, evil (adjective)
- bad, disagreeable, malignant
- bad, unpleasant, evil (giving pain, unhappiness, misery)
- evil, displeasing
- bad (of its kind - land, water, etc)
- bad (of value)
- worse than, worst (comparison)
- sad, unhappy
- evil (hurtful)
- bad, unkind (vicious in disposition)
- bad, evil, wicked (ethically)
- in general, of persons, of thoughts
- deeds, actions
- evil, distress, misery, injury, calamity (noun masculine)
- evil, distress, adversity
- evil, injury, wrong
- evil (ethical)
- evil, misery, distress, injury (noun feminine)
- evil, misery, distress
- evil, injury, wrong
- evil (ethical)
